The Commercial Contract Manager is responsible for overseeing the end-to-end lifecycle of commercial contracts, ensuring contractual compliance, minimizing risk, and maximizing business value. This role partners closely with sales, legal, finance, procurement, and operational teams to negotiate, review, and manage complex commercial agreements while supporting organizational objectives and customer satisfaction.
 
Responsibilities
  • Lead the preparation, review, negotiation, and administration of commercial contracts, including customer, supplier, and partner agreements.
  • Ensure all contractual terms align with company policies, legal requirements, and commercial objectives.
  • Identify, assess, and mitigate contractual, financial, and operational risks.
  • Monitor contract performance, obligations, milestones, renewals, and amendments throughout the contract lifecycle.
  • Provide commercial guidance during bid, proposal, and sales activities to optimize outcomes and protect company interests.
  • Maintain accurate contract records and reporting within contract management systems.
  • Support compliance initiatives and contribute to the continuous improvement of contracting processes and governance frameworks.
  • Manage customer and stakeholder relationships to facilitate successful contract execution and issue resolution.
Qualifications

You Have: 

  • Proven experience managing the full contract lifecycle, including proposal support, contract drafting, negotiation, award, execution, contract administration, change management, renewals, and closeout activities.
  • Demonstrated ability to draft, review, and negotiate a wide range of commercial agreements, including customer contracts, amendments, subcontracts, Non-Disclosure Agreements (NDAs), teaming agreements, Memorandums of Understanding (MOUs), End User License Agreements (EULAs), and Maintenance & Support Agreements.
  • Strong commercial acumen with the ability to identify, assess, and mitigate contractual, financial, and operational risks while supporting business objectives.
  • Experience collaborating with cross-functional teams, including Legal, Supply Chain, Engineering, Finance, Sales, and Program Management, to ensure contractual obligations, compliance requirements, and business priorities are effectively managed.
  • Experience utilizing Contract Lifecycle Management (CLM) systems to manage contract workflows, approvals, documentation, reporting, and governance processes.
  • Comfortable using AI-assisted contract review, analysis, and drafting tools to improve efficiency, identify risks, and enhance contract management processes.
  • Bachelor's degree in business, Finance, Supply Chain, Procurement, Legal Studies, or a related field, or equivalent professional experience.

    It would be nice if you also had:

  • Juris Doctor (JD) degree or paralegal/legal studies background.
  • Professional certifications such as Certified Commercial Contracts Manager (CCCM), Certified Federal Contracts Manager (CFCM), or similar contract management credentials.

What you need to know about the Montreal Tech Scene

With roots dating back to 1642, Montreal is often recognized for its French-inspired architecture and cobblestone streets lined with traditional shops and cafés. But what truly sets the city apart is how it blends its rich tradition with a modern edge, reflected in its evolving skyline and fast-growing tech industry. According to economic promotion agency Montréal International, the city ranks among the top in North America to invest in artificial intelligence, making it le spot idéal for job seekers who want the best of both worlds.

Key Facts About Montreal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 255,000+ (2024, Tourisme Montréal)
  • Major Tech Employers: SAP, Google, Microsoft, Cisco
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, machine learning, cybersecurity, cloud computing, web development
  • Funding Landscape: $1.47 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(BetaKit)
  • Notable Investors: CIBC Innovation Banking, BDC Capital, Investissement Québec, Fonds de solidarité FTQ
  • Research Centers and Universities: McGill University, Université de Montréal, Concordia University, Mila Quebec, ÉTS Montréal
